Via the “Settings” menu of your Motorola Moto C Plus

You can easily go to the Date & Time menu via the ‘settings’ menu and then the ‘general’ tab of your Motorola Moto C Plus.
If the ‘auto-tuning’ option is checked, then refer to our section on automatic tuning below. Otherwise, two setting options are available as follows.

Using your Motorola Moto C Plus time zones

In this same ‘date and time’ menu of your Motorola Moto C Plus, you should have the option to set the time zone for your Motorola Moto C Plus.

This is an interesting option if you travel a lot.

You can choose to set the time zone manually, or synchronize it on your operator network. We advise you to use the second option for ease.

By setting the date and time yourself

If you want to have full hands on your phone time, then go to the ‘set time’ category of your Motorola Moto C Plus. This is where you can set the date and time of your choice, as on any watch.

Via the automatic setting

This is the most interesting option to set the time on your Motorola Moto C Plus.

Note that you must be connected to a telephone network in order to use it.

The time of this network will then be displayed on your phone.

This option is easily activated by checking the ‘automatic setting’ box in your date and time menu.

To conclude on the date and time on your Motorola Moto C Plus

When you are traveling or when you switch to summer or winter time, the automatic time zone or time setting will be performed if the option has been selected in your Motorola Moto C Plus.

If this does not work, make sure your phone system is updated.

To do this, activate the automatic update or do it manually.
